The worlds nicest bookshop is in Budapest

I am not sure if this is true, but today it was the official opening of the  Paris Big  Store located in the Andrássy Út. The building which has been a fashion shop throughout decades was closed in 1999, and today they opened it again. But this time it is not with clothes, but with tons of books and some wine!

I was inside there today (unfortunately I did not bring my camera) and it looks absolutely amazing. The facade has been renovated and it looks great from the outside as well. Inside you will immediately see wine on your right hand and the cashiers on your right side. As you walk straight ahead and up the stairs you will start to realize why this is beautiful. There is a bridge which you can walk across the two sides on the first floor of the building. The cafeteria which had a piano player playing nice music looks gorgeous and it felt almost like the entrance of the Hungarian State Opera… paintings in the roof, gold and beauty! I have not visited such a beautiful bookshop before at least!

Take a look yourself. The address is Andrássy út 35, and it is an Alexandra book store you can find inside the building.

New shopping center opening in Budapest

Today, November 11 at 11.00, a new shopping center will open in Budapest, the Allee Center. The center is located by the end station of tram line 4, Fehérvári Út, a great location on the Budaside and with loads of people who might be possible customers in the new center.

Inside the Allee Center you will not only find shops, but there is also a fitness club there, cinema opportunities, offices and flats for sale (though I guess most of them are sold already)!

Night of the Baths 2009
The Night of the Baths is the evening/night where you can swim and enjoy the thermal water in Budapest until after midnight and enjoy nice programs as you do so.

In the Gellért Bath there will be music from the 90’s, in Rudás Fürdő there will be bellydancing and in Szechényi Fürdő there will be live music entertaining the guests.

I guess it will be quite cold outside on December 4, but if you stay in the water you will for sure enjoy even the outdoor pools at the Szechényi Thermal Bath (which by the way is extremely nice and has a great atmosphere after the sun has gone down)!
